The Audi Dublin International Film Festival is excited to announce the launch of the inaugural Immersive Stories: Conference & Exhibition curated by Eoghan Cunneen, a Senior Software Engineer at Lucasfilm Ltd, San Francisco.

This major new addition to the ADIFF programme will take place over two days on February 24th and 25th, 2018, and will feature a variety of keynote speakers and an interactive exhibition.

The event will feature speakers who tell stories across multiple platforms with backgrounds that span three distinct areas: fictional story-worlds, news and documentary and music and sound. The speakers will provide insight into their work and how they leverage these platforms to their full potential.

 

Speakers include:
Diana Williams, Content Strategist, Lucasfilm Ltd (Star Wars)
Neil Leyden, Head of RTE.ie
Aoife Doyle & Niamh Herrity, Co-Founders, Pink Kong Studios
Colum Slevin, Head of Experiences, Oculcs VR
Curtis Hickman, Founder, The Void
